“…Combining fuzzy logic and meta-heuristic algorithms can fully leverage their respective strengths and enhance capabilities in addressing intricate optimization problems. The generation of fuzzy rules in [13] involves considering energy and utility factors, and the fuzzy inference system is employed to identify relay nodes. The minimum length route is determined based on coverage distance, energy, utility factor, and bandwidth availability.…”

“…Ramkumar K [ 20 ] proposed fuzzy-based relay node selection and energy-efficient routing (FRNSEER) to enhance QoS performance in WSNs. The FRNSEER selects the best sink node among active relay nodes to collect data from sensor nodes; sensor hubs were applied to link sensor nodes to the sink.…”
